Mondraker Zero Platform
Zero is a virtual pivot system, with the rear shock floating between two system links. compressing the shock simultaneously on both sides. Thanks to the pivot and shock’s optimum position the Zero suspension system offers clear advantages when compared to the other systems, providing exceptional sensitivity not possible with a mono-pivot design.
Zero offers total pedaling independence, no noticeable chain elongation, no brake jack and outstanding bump absorption to shrug off big obstacles and enable you to handle even the toughest terrain.
